Minimize rather than close window of Wrike Desktop

At work I can have many open windows. Sometimes I close window of Wrike for Windows mistakenly. It takes some time for it to be started again.

Can you add an option so that when I click on X, Wrike window can be minimized rather than closed?

Hi Stephen,

Thanks for the reply.

I understand standard behaviours of - and X buttons are defined by OS. However, I noticed Skype and Slack desktop versions overwrite behaviour of X button by minimizing themselves instead.

Adding a confirmation could be useful. However, I still think it is better to give user an option to define behaviour of X button. After all, most users only need to open & close Wrike once per day.

Yes, in the Mac application, I was trying it out as I often have 8-10-20 Wrike tabs open at a time, typically in Chrome but my muscle memory for closing single tabs with Command-W inadvertently shut down all 8 tabs I had running all at once, with not only no opportunity to re-open them,  but to open ANY window again w/o quitting and restarting the program.  

 

Photoshop allows the re-mapping of all kinds of system-level keystrokes while in the app.  While I like the idea of this app to separate from my other browsing needs, without being able to re-map Command-W (close window) to close Tab, I simply won't be able to use it.   

In the cases of Chrome, Safari and Firefox, they all support Command-W as close Tab and Command-Shift-W as closing the entire window regardless of how many tabs open

Hi all, I know this is pretty old, but in case it hasn't been fixed yet, @Stephen, Something similar to the following is what they're looking for. And I concur with their wants as well.

Write a event in Form Closing event.

 private void Form1_FormClosing(object sender, FormClosingEventArgs e)
 {
        e.Cancel = true;                         
        Hide();
 }

And write using Custom menu strip for notification icon for to show.
